Physicists Hourly Pay

Median hourly wage: $82.81

Hourly Wage Percentiles

PercentileHourly Wage
10th$39.48
25th$53.71
Median$82.81
75th$107.10
90th$131.79

Data source: BLS OES national file · U.S. BLS OES, May 2024 (updated April 2025)

Frequently Asked Questions

How much do physicists make an hour?

The median hourly wage is $82.81; the mean hourly wage is $82.30.

What is the entry-level hourly pay for physicists?

Workers at the 10th percentile earn about $39.48 per hour — a common proxy for entry-level pay.

What is the top hourly pay for physicists?

Workers at the 90th percentile earn about $131.79 per hour.
